The lyrebird has the most unique imitation features in the entire animal kingdom. Due to variations … WebFrom pigeons in big cities to penguins in Antarctica, all birds have similar features. They all have wings, though they cannot all fly. All birds also have feathers . In fact, birds are the only living animals that have feathers.

WebBirds. lay eggs with a hard shell. are covered with feathers. have a beak. have two legs. have two wings used for flying (ostriches and penguins are flightless). have hollow bones. are warm-blooded. Reptiles. lay eggs with leathery shells or give birth to fully-formed young. breathe with lungs. are covered with scales. have no legs or four legs ...
